Popis: Introduction: With the populational aging, a number of chronic and degenerative illnesses, common in the old age, will present more and more frequently. Purpose: To perform a literature review that addresses the most commonly manifested illnesses in third-age patients (ranging from chronic illnesses up to degenerative chronic illnesses). For such purpose, a description will be made regarding the concept and signs and symptoms of the most frequently observed illnesses in elderly patients, namely depression, stress, loss of memory, atherosclerosis, osteoporosis, rheumatoid arthritis, temporomandibular disorders, hypertension, vascular diseases, cardiac diseases, obesity, diabetes mellitus, urinary incontinence, hearing and visual disturbances, Parkinson’s disease and Alzheimer’s disease. Conclusions: Based on the review of literature, it may be concluded that not only health professionals, but all individuals that deal with elderly people in general should treat them with in a more attentive, patient, perseverant manner in order to minimize the limitations that each individual presents
